Full job description
Job Description:
• Project Focus: Managing a variety of sustainability projects, which are highly critical. This includes several net-new projects spinning up, which are globally based.
• Stakeholder & Vendor Management: Managing both internal teams and external suppliers, as well as overseeing partnerships that are onsite across various locations.
• Financial Stewardship: Taking full ownership of project financials, tracking budgets, and ensuring fiscal accountability.
• Experience: 7+ years of dedicated experience managing external stakeholders.
• Leadership Style: A high energy, dependable leader who is ready to jump in on day one and hold teams accountable to deadlines.
• Communication: Exceptional communication and relationship-building skills to establish strong trust quickly across the organization.
• Tools: Previous experience with the Procore project management tool is highly preferred.
• Travel: Some travel will be required depending on the specific projects assigned. Candidates should be comfortable with visiting certain sites up to twice a month, with the potential for occasional global travel
Responsibilities:
• Manage project inception from the pre-construction processes through financial close-out to maximize the quality of the space constructed for the users and groups while always attempting to implement value-engineering alternatives to lessen the cost of construction for Client.
• Provide strategic oversight and direction to regional project teams, managers, and consultants.
• Foster a collaborative and high-performance culture across dispersed, multi-cultural project teams.
• Responsible for multiple projects concurrently. This includes Global Projects across different time zones.
• Maintain financial forecast and oversee project cost tracking throughout projects. Includes monthly forecasting and quarterly reporting across all projects.
• Partner with the Workplace and Sustainability team in consulting with internal stakeholders to understand space and furniture needs and assist in space planning, balancing end user needs with cost efficient solutions.
• Work closely with Client’s BT and Global Workplace Safety teams to ensure that technology solutions (including audio visual, low voltage cabling, access control system) are captured in design.
• Ensure that Client’s space and/or building standards are implemented throughout the design.
• Communicate effectively with REWS workmates and senior management and other employees to discuss requirements planned for the design.
• Understand and provide furniture specifications to suppliers to create detailed layouts.
• Communicate with the BT team, security teams, external engineers, external furniture vendors, end users, property management and general contractor, ensuring that all groups have required information.
• Develop and use collaborative relationships to facilitate the accomplishment of work goals.
• Effectively manage time and resources to ensure that work is completed efficiently.
• Maintain knowledge of industry, products, methods, and promotional strategies, as well as trends in workplace design.
• Create and manage project schedules to ensure deliverables are on track.
Basic Qualifications
• Bachelor degree or an equivalent combination of construction background and technical degree in Civil/Mechanical/Electrical Engineering or Construction Management
• Minimum 10+ years of progressive experience in construction project management, with significant experience in global or multi-country project delivery.
• 8+ years of people leadership experience
• Financial analysis experience and familiarity with accounting and financial concepts of real estate, capital projects and operations expenses
• Exceptional cross-cultural communication and negotiation skills. Strong leadership and mentorship abilities for international teams. Proven ability to travel globally as required.
Other Qualifications
• Strong proficiency with Procore, OpenSpace, and MS Office Suite.
• Expert knowledge of various Project Delivery Methods (Design-Build, CM at Risk, IPD, etc.). Proficiency in project management software, scheduling tools, and financial/cost management systems.
• Excellent interpersonal skills including significant oral, presentation and written communication skills and professional presence
• Detailed understanding of industry standards, including workplace practices, corporate management, office technology, and environmental factors.
• PMP or other industry certification is preferred.
